Analysis

Botswana recorded 50.89 current US$ per person for personal remittances, received (current us$), per capita in 2024.

That represents a change of up 80.2% on the previous year and up 139.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, personal remittances, received (current us$), per capita in Botswana peaked at 86.15 current US$ per person in 1977 and was at its lowest, 7.64 current US$ per person, in 2009.

That places Botswana 141st out of 197 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Botswana compared with similar countries

  • Botswana's 50.89 current US$ per person is below the median for upper middle income countries, which is 275.26 current US$ per person, 18% of the median. (57 countries reporting)
  • Botswana's 50.89 current US$ per person is above the median for Sub-Saharan Africa, which is 31.85 current US$ per person, 1.6× the median. (47 countries reporting)

How this figure is calculated

Personal remittances, received (current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Personal remittances, received (current US$) ÷ Population, total
